In short

VIVI proposes a contentious reversal: instead of loading ready-made knowledge into the system, let intelligence form gradually out of experience and memory. For now it is precisely a research hypothesis — the description carries no results by which to judge whether it worked.

The main risk with VIVI is not that the project is trying to build "intelligence like a living creature's". The risk is different: without a vast store of ready-made knowledge the system may end up not more intelligent but simply far less useful at the start.

The project proposes abandoning the familiar scheme. Today's AI usually acquires knowledge from large corpora before it starts working and is then fine-tuned. VIVI wants intelligence to appear gradually — through accumulating experience, memory, self-organisation of knowledge, the formation of concepts and of an internal model of the world.

There is an important idea in that. A pretrained model answers quickly because a large part of the work has already been done in advance. But its knowledge and its ways of generalising are formed in advance too. VIVI treats intelligence as a process of development rather than a set of ready weights: the system should not only extract an answer from statistics but build its own picture of the world.

For an applied user this is not yet a new replacement for ChatGPT but a direction for experiment. The approach could potentially yield more independent learning and memory, but the price of the idea is a slow start and the need to solve on your own the problems that ordinary models have already closed off through pretraining.

The limitations of the description are substantial: it does not disclose VIVI's architecture, its training method, experimental results, metrics or examples of the system's behaviour. So it cannot be claimed that cognitive intelligence has already appeared. So far only the intent is confirmed — to grow it without a vast pretrained language model.
